Transaction 95705702ca06d6494fdd6139fef5476b528e6d9bc3a5b6a94063bcecc7c729b7
1 Input
1 Output
-
95705702ca06d6494fdd6139fef5476b528e6d9bc3a5b6a94063bcecc7c729b7:0
- value
- 68858
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ddece303b2e232c064b0ea237fe5ef0469d302c8
- address
- bc1qmhkwxqajugevqe9sag3hle00q35axqkgch286h